what is the difference (if anything) between an I-beam and a girder?
Feb 07, 8497 by Andrew | Posted in Engineering
I can't reckon it out. What's a girder and what's an i-beam? Please include links to pictures of both. Thanks
the administration conditions "I-beam" was coined because the cross section of the beam looks like the letter "I". However, in the engineering community, these beams are called encyclopaedic flange beams, or S beams. The wide flange beams have a wider flange than do the S beams.
The term "girder" only means a pencil which supports other beams which frame into the girder.
You can go to aisc.org and look at what is available in the steel book.
